#c5450d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c5450d is composed of 77.3% red, 27.1%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65% magenta, 93.4%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 18.3 degrees, a saturation of 87.6% and a lightness of 41.2%. #c5450d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8a1a with #8b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#c5450d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c5450d has RGB values of R:197, G:69,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.93,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12928269.

Shades and Tints of #c5450d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0501 is the darkest color, while #fffbfa is the lightest one.
